This past weekend, Andrew and I went to our favorite spot in the world, Mount Airy, NC. For years, we’ve gone to this wonderful little corner of the world for relaxation, rejuvenation, drive-in movies, excellent food…heck, we even got married there!

Fall is an absolutely gorgeous time in Mt. Airy, so if you’re anywhere near the NC mountains, you should totally check it out. Here are three of our favorite spots that we visited this weekend:

1. The Downtown Cinema on Saturday mornings – If you’re a musician, or anyone who enjoys music, you’ve gotta go check out the amazing bluegrass and old time music here. For early risers, there’s a jam session from 9-10:30am, and then from 11am-1:30ish, they do a live radio broadcast with some excellent mountain musicians. Must hear, must hear, must hear!!

2. The 308 Bistro – Located in the Old North State Winery in downtown Mt. Airy, the 308 Bistro offers excellent food at musician-friendly prices. The restaurant is run by Twyla from the Maxwell House Bed and Breakfast, another of our favorite Mount Airy spots!

3. Utt’s Campground – Utt’s is actually located just up the mountain from Mt. Airy, in Fancy Gap, VA. It’s beautiful, quiet, and only $16 per night for tent camping! We especially enjoyed the walking trail, and getting the chance to meet the various cats and puppies that share the mountain with the campers.
